- To configure the phone for IPv6, from the Android home screen:
- Touch the left most menu key in the bottom panel, tap Settings
- Select Wireless & networks
- Select Mobile networks
- Select Access Point Names
- Touch the left most menu key in the bottom panel, tap New APN
- Set the following fields
- Name = v6
- APN = epc.tmobile.com
- APN protocol = IPv6
- APN type = default
- Touch the left most menu key in the bottom panel, tap save
- Tap the "go back" arrow from the bottom keys, select the new "v6" APN as so that it has the blue ball
- You may need to reboot your phone.
- Here are some screenshots of how the mobile network APN should look
- You can validate IPv6 access my going to ip6.me which will display your IPv6 address. There is a more detailed IPv6 test at Test your IPv6.
- To remove these settings and go back to IPv4 default, from the Access Point Names menu, select the left most key, and tap Restore to default
